W= width L= length = 2W
Area of Rectangle= Length * Widthsubstitute the area and the value of L in the formula
28,800 m^2= 2W * W
28,800= 2W^2divide both sides by 2 in an effort to isolate the variable w
14,400= W^2take the square root of both sides
√14,400= W^2
we want the negative and positive root of the radicand (the number under the radical symbol - 14,400 in this case)
120= w OR -120= w
LENGTHL= 2W= 2(120)= 240 meters
ANSWER: The side lengths are W= 120 m; L= 240 m. Even though W= -120 too, it is not a valid solution in this case since a field cannot have a negative value.

In order to answer this one, it's really really really really helpful if you know what the law of cosines says. In fact it's absolutely necessary.
The law of cosines says if you know two sides of a triangle and the angle between them then you can use that information to find the length of the third side.
In the picture you know the lengths of two sides and you know the angle between them. So you can use the law of cosines to find the length of the third sidethat. That's side AC.
